Mps, acbl tourney. E dealt, opened 3H, passed out, making 5.
I'm S. Our score was a bit over 40%. I'm not fretting all that much but still... The opps are in a part score making 5, we cannot make 4S (surely the opening lead will be the ace of hearts, producing a heart 3 from E and then a club shift, although some did make 4S). N commented that if I overcall 3S he would raise to 4, down only 1. Well, yes, but if they decide to take a nv sac over our freely bid vul game I presume a pass of 5H is forcing allowing us to choose between 5HX making and 5SX down 500.
LOTT, before adjustments, says 8+9=17 total tricks and there are in fact 11+9=20. I know there are adjustments in volume 2, but that seems like a lot of adjusting.
It's not clear to me anyone is supposed to do anything different (although if I were E I would consider opening 4H, or even 1H, instead of 3).
I'm interested in any thoughts anyone might have. Some lucky souls got to play 3S making. Stuff happens.
